Austin, Texas
This luxury downtown property is ideally suited for one or two people but can sleep 4 guests in two queen beds. Located just two blocks from S. Congress (SoCo) and Lady Bird Lake, it's the perfect place for a weekend getaway or reprieve from a business trip. Walk to arts and entertainment or stay in and enjoy the privacy of the beautiful grounds. The guest house is an open space with 360 square feet and a 15-foot cathedral ceiling with exposed beams. There is a Queen bed on the main level and a queen bed in the loft plus one bathroom. The kitchen has everything you need including, one electric hotplate, microwave/convection oven, coffee pot, tea kettle, toaster, blender, under-counter refrigerator, and outdoor gas grill. The dining table seats four and the outdoor space has three club chairs, one additional chair, and a hammock. The owner lives on site but the outdoor space is separated by a fence. The house was built in 1928 and resembles a European cottage. The guesthouse was constructed in 2006 and recently remodeled in 2021. The property and grounds have been published in various magazines, featured in commercials, and have been open for public outdoor garden tours. Casement windows surround the guest house with beautiful views of the gardens and numerous heritage Live Oak trees. Google fiber is available for high-speed internet access. This property is for the exclusive enjoyment of paying guests only. There is a strict noise ordinance by 10:30 p.m.
